Comprehending Car Key Programming
Car key programming includes syncing a key or key fob with the Vehicle Key Programming‘s immobilizer system. When a key is programmed, it permits the vehicle to acknowledge it as a genuine key, licensing the user to start the engine. This procedure can vary in intricacy depending upon the kind of type in question:
- Traditional Keys: These are simple metal keys that need no programming.
- Transponder Keys: These keys include a chip that must be programmed to the vehicle.
- Key Fobs: These typically include remote functions, such as locking/unlocking doors and might require specialized programming.
- Smart Keys: These advanced systems permit keyless entry and ignition, representing the most detailed programming requirements.

1. Car dealerships
One of the most simple places to get a car key programmed is at an authorized car dealership. Dealers concentrate on particular makes and models, guaranteeing they have the equipment and understanding to program keys accurately.
Advantages:
- Access to manufacturer-specific equipment.
- Assurance of top quality service and genuine parts.
Disadvantages:
- Higher costs than other choices.
- Waiting times might differ, particularly if parts are needed.
2. Automotive Locksmiths
Automotive locksmiths are gaining popularity as a practical alternative for key programming. These professionals provide the advantage of Mobile Key Programming Near Me services, allowing them to come to your place.
Benefits:
- Generally cheaper than dealerships.
- Benefit of mobile service.
Downsides:
- Not all locksmiths have the exact same level of knowledge.
- They may not carry OEM parts.
3. Independent Repair Shops
For those searching for a middle ground in between car dealerships and locksmiths, independent repair shops are a strong choice. They are often equipped to deal with various programming tasks at an affordable price.
Advantages:
- Competitive prices compared to dealerships.
- Familiarity with multiple vehicle brands.
Drawbacks:
- Technical capabilities may vary.
- Quality of parts may not match OEM requirements.
4. Do It Yourself Programming Kits
For the adventurous and tech-savvy, DIY car key programming kits are available in the market. These sets can enable car owners to program keys themselves, providing a significant cost-saving procedure.
Benefits:
- Cost-effective for those efficient in utilizing the package.
- Chance to find out about car key innovation.
Downsides:
- There is a finding out curve and risk of making errors.
- Limited support if issues emerge.

Frequently Asked Questions About Car Key Programming
1. Just how much does it cost to have a car key programmed?
The cost of programming a car key can differ commonly based upon the kind of Key Fob Programming Near Me and the provider. Generally, car dealerships charge between ₤ 100– ₤ 300, while locksmith services may vary from ₤ 50– ₤ 150.
2. Can I program a car key myself?
Yes, some vehicles support DIY programming, particularly older models or those with simpler key systems. Nevertheless, most modern keys need customized devices.
3. For how long does the programming process take?
The programming procedure can take anywhere from a couple of minutes to several hours, depending upon the complexity of the key and the provider’s work.
4. What if I lose my only car key?
If you lose your only key, you will likely require to tow your vehicle to a dealer or locksmith professional. They can produce a brand-new key using your vehicle’s VIN or by accessing its security system.
5. Is it safe to use a locksmith for key programming?
Yes, but it is crucial to select a respectable locksmith professional to guarantee they have the ideal knowledge and equipment for your vehicle.
